Description:First edition. Oblong quarto. 26 x 34.5 cms. Illustrated by 30 lithographs. Bound in contemporary pebbled cloth, front cover with title "AlbumCubano". CADA GRABADO ES UNA JOYA PRIMERA EDICION.   ALBUM PINTORESCO IS THE MOST BEAUTIFUL AND EVOCATIVE 19TH CENTURY BOOK OF VIEWS OF CUBA Oblong quarto. Frontispiece, 30  lithographs views and one folding map of Havana. This splendid book of views evokes the island of Cuba as it flourished in the mid-19th century, a vibrant tropical haven with a splendid capital that served as a center of trade between Europe and the Americas. One of the oldest cities founded by Europeans in the western hemisphere, Havana and all of Cuba had become something of a destination for travelers as well as merchants when these views were made. Several of the scenes included in this album show Cuba's scenic ports teeming with the clipper ships and commercial vessels, some depicted masterfully in a moonlit setting. The views of Havana are particularly notable, showing the development of one of the oldest New World cities. In 1607, just over a century after Columbus made landfall in Cuba in 1492, Havana became the capital of the island and the front door to the vast Spanish colonial empire. The city was physically untouched by the wars of independence in the latter half of the 18th century, and thus remains the finest surviving Spanish complex in the Americas. Though the face of Cuba has changed considerably, its distinctive vibrancy is depicted vividly in these stunning 19th-century views, which illustrate not only on the island's ports and harbors,  scenes of everyday life and customs, including bull fighting and tobacco farming.
